-- TASK Innovations GmbH’s expansion into the African market is highlighted as a strategic move to reshape the logistics landscape. With a long-term vision led by CEO Thomas Kopp, the company aims to tackle Africa’s logistical challenges and help elevate the continent’s economic development. The company's investments focus on optimizing logistics operations while promoting sustainable practices. As part of this strategy, the African subsidiary Intercont Logistics & Trading will play a central role in implementing region-specific logistics solutions on the ground.

About the Company:
TASK Innovations GmbH is a Vienna-based holding company founded in 2022 by logistics expert Thomas Kopp, who brings over 30 years of industry experience. The company specializes in strategic investments across the logistics, technology, and creative sectors. Committed to sustainable growth and digital innovation, TASK Innovations fosters strong local and international partnerships. The company is also expanding its reach into global markets, including recent initiatives on the African continent, where it promotes transformative, future-oriented logistics solutions.
